John C. Reilly & Steve Coogan Bring 'Stan & Ollie' To New York!

John C. Reilly and Steve Coogan flash a smile together while hitting the red carpet at the screening of their new film Stan & Ollie at Elinor Bunin Munroe Film Center on Monday (December 10) in New York City

The were pair were joined by the film’s screenwriter Jeff Pope and director Jon S. Baird, as well as Cuba Gooding Jr., producer Frank Whaley, Paul Schneider and Celia Weston who came out to show their support.

Stan & Ollie follows the story of Laurel & Hardy, one of the world’s great comedy teams, set out on a variety hall tour of Britain in 1953. Diminished by age and with their golden era as the kings of Hollywood comedy now behind them, they face an uncertain future. As the charm and beauty of their performances shines through, they re-connect with their adoring fans – Watch the trailer below!

Carla Gugino, Miles McMillan, Christopher Meloni & More Support 'Roma' NYC Screening!

Carla Gugino happily strikes a pose on the carpet while attending a special screening of the critically acclaimed Netflix movie Roma held on Tuesday (November 27) at the Directors Guild of America (DGA) Theater in New York City.

The 47-year-old Haunting of Hill House star was joined at the event by Miles McMillan, Christopher Meloni, Shiloh Fernandez, Tobias Sorensen, Ben Sinclair, Nick Kroll, Alex Lundqvist, Cuba Gooding Jr. and Dean Winters as they all stepped out to show their support.

The film was directed by Alfonso Cuaron and it’s getting a ton of awards buzz. While it won’t be released on Netflix until December 14, the film was released in limited theaters this past weekend.

The movie played in only three theaters in New York and Los Angeles and while Netflix isn’t reporting grosses for the screenings, sources tell THR that nearly all showings were sold out. The film grossed around $90,000 to $120,000 over opening weekend.

Bryan Cranston, Imogen Poots, Michael Sheen & More Step Out for Olivier Awards 2018!

Bryan Cranston hits the stage to accept his award during the 2018 Olivier Awards with Mastercard held at the Royal Albert Hall on Sunday (April 8) in London, England.

The 62-year-old actor took home the award for Best Actor for his role in Network at National Theatre – Lyttelton. “The idea that older white men are controlling the world and having free reign is over,” Bryan joked while accepting the award.

“Invisible of gender, of sexual preference, of colour, let’s build it up with mutual respect of everyone,” Bryan added. “Right now it’s muddy, it’s tough, but there’s hope in that.”

Also in attendance at the award ceremony were Cuba Gooding Jr, Michael Sheen, Imogen Poots, Alfred Enoch, Andy Karl, Alexandra Burke, Andrew Scott, Patti LuPone and Andrew Lloyd Webber.

Cuba Gooding Jr. Says He Turned Down Roles in 'Ray,' 'Hotel Rwanda' & More

Cuba Gooding Jr. says he was offered a lot of really great roles in the past, but turned them down.

Some of the directors he turned down working with were Steven Spielberg (for Amistad), Michael Mann (for Collateral), Terry George (for Hotel Rwanda), and Taylor Hackford for the lead in the Ray Charles biopic that landed Jamie Foxx an Oscar.

“I had all these big directors offering me roles, and I read their scripts and said, ‘I don’t think this part is right for me.’ And what happens is, if you offend enough big directors, you get taken off their lists,” he told The Guardian.

“Oh yeah, I did some real clunkers,” Cuba said, adding it wasn’t because of money.“Not for me. For me, it was always about protecting the sanctity of that golden statue… Because I felt I needed to show people that I can do more, I can do better.”

Then, he was reminded, “You just reminded me of another one – I’m kicking my balls in this interview – I was offered Idi Amin in The Last King Of Scotland. And I said to myself, ‘I can’t do that. He’s a bad guy!’”

Cuba won an Oscar in 1997 for Jerry Maguire, and has since made Snow Dogs, Boat Trip, Ticking Clock, The Way Of War, Wrong Turn At Tahoe, Ryan Murphy‘s American Crime Story, and more.

Julianna Margulies & Hubby Keith Lieberthal Couple Up at Welcoming Dinner for Alessia Antinori!

Julianna Margulies is all smiles while posing alongside her handsome hubby Keith Liberthal at the Welcoming Dinner for Alessia Antinori held at Tutto il Giorno restaurant on Wednesday (February 22) in New York City.

The 51-year-old Emmy-winning actress was joined at the event by Cuba Gooding Jr., Christie Brinkley, Katie Couric, Gina Gershon, Fox news anchor Rosanna Scotto, Cinema Society‘s Andrew Saffir and partner Daniel Benedict, Gabby Karan, and Alessia Antinori herself.

Alessia represents the 26th Generation of the esteemed winemaker Marchesi Antinori, one of the longest-running family businesses in the world. She is now leading the legendary company along with her two sisters. Established in 1385, Antinori has exuded influence in wine and culture for centuries as Italy’s oldest and most prestigious producer with estates throughout its top regions, and around the world.

Ben Stiller & Cuba Cooding Jr. Serve Guests at TIFF Gala

Ben Stiller and Cuba Gooding Jr. wear their waiter uniforms while standing in the kitchen at the Artists for Peace and Justice Gala held during the 2017 Toronto International Film Festival on Sunday (September 10) in Toronto, Canada.

The guys co-hosted the event alongside Morgan Spurlock, Paul Haggis, and more. All of the co-hosts jumped up from their seats and proceeded to serve the guests!

$1.1 million was raised at the event, presented by Bovet 1822, to support education in Haiti.

Cuba entertained the crowd by singing “Oh Canada” and asking the people in attendance to “show him the money” during the live auction.
